May 26, 1934 – Aug. 2, 2012

FERRIDAY — Services for Carolyn “GG” Foster Craft, 78, of Waterproof, who died Thursday, Aug. 2, 2012, at her residence, will be at 2 p.m. Sunday at Young’s Funeral Home in Ferriday.

Burial will follow at Highland Park Cemetery under the direction of Young’s Funeral Home.

Visitation will be from 5 to 8 p.m. today at the funeral home.

Mrs. Craft was born May 26, 1934, in Prentiss, the daughter of John Foster and Lessie Foster. She was an active Baptist.

Mrs. Craft was preceded in death by her husband, Travis Rayford Craft; her parents; one son, Danny Craft; three brothers, John Kirkley, Jessie Kirkley and Jack Kirkley; and two sisters, Frances Herrington and Mildred Foster.

Survivors include one daughter, Debbie Felder and husband, Gary, of Denham Springs, La.; one brother, Bill Foster of Prentiss; one sister, Lois Gilbert of Eureka, Calif.; an adopted daughter, Sadie Easom of Ferriday; nine grandchildren, Amber Rhodes, Tori Murry, Danny Craft Jr., Rebecca Jordan, Adam Craft, Melanie Morace, Chris Felder, Summer Felder and Jessica Gaston; three special friends, Joan Pitcher, Cecillia Hoffman and Betty King; and a number of family, friends, nieces and nephews.

Pallbearers will be Danny Craft Jr., Adam Craft, Travis Murry, Cade Murry, Sidney Plaisance and Joe Morace.

Honorary pallbearers will be Dr. Huey Moak, the Rev. Corcky Evans, Bill Colvin and Matt Colvin.

The family extends a special thanks to Camilla Hospice for the care they gave and showed.
